A dedicated, well-qualified and inspirational Head of English is required to lead this established department from September 2019. The post is full time, leading the teaching of English throughout the school in the 4-13 age range.

This is an exceptional opportunity to inspire children to enjoy and be challenged by the subject within and beyond school hours. The successful candidate will produce the best possible results in examinations, extending and challenging the most able children, who will gain academic scholarships, and supporting those who will need support and care to pass their Common Entrance exams. At the same time, he or she will inspire a love of English and foster independent thinking and learning within the curriculum and beyond, through clubs, events and trips, such as the School’s Book Week.

All teachers will wish to play a full part in the life of the school, including contributing to both the pastoral care and tutoring system and the wide range of extra-curricular activities.

St John’s College School is an independent co-educational school with approximately 480 children aged 4-13, which has long enjoyed a national reputation for the exceptional quality of education and care it provides.  

The successful candidate will hold QTS status, and have a good honours degree and a PGCE in an appropriate discipline, together with a successful teaching record in the relevant age group.
